Cinematic Experiences and AI's Role
This chapter examines the relationship between visual media and viewer experience, focusing on the interplay of film theory and machine vision. The speakers discuss how computational techniques impact spectatorship and the evolution of cinematic storytelling, while also exploring the potential of artificial intelligence in bridging theoretical gaps. Additionally, they address the implications of AI-generated images on emotional responses and the evolving nature of cinematic time.
